Mohit Appari

Data Scientist | Quant Research & Systematic Trading
APD, Florida

I'm a Data Scientist researching systematic trading strategies, grounded in academic factor literature (Jegadeesh-Titman momentum, Fama-French/Carhart factors, Hamilton regime-switching models) and validated through rigorous backtesting. I built a Hidden Markov Model-based market regime detector that outperformed static strategies on a walk-forward out-of-sample test (Sharpe 0.769 vs. 0.641, drawdown -25.6% vs. -33.7%), and a full-stack quantitative research platform combining a multi-factor scoring model with a backtesting engine, regime filter, and live paper-trading execution across 500+ tickers. Experience

Data Scientist  @  APD
June 2025 – Present
Performed forecasting and budgeting analysis on ~$200M in monthly financial transactions, producing charts, supporting data, and reports used for rate-change decisions and financial planning. Conducted research and trend analysis across a 60,000+ client base (state waiver program), tracking client movement between services, service utilization patterns, and data integrity issues.
Built and maintained 40+ automated data pipelines processing 300K+ records (Python, SQL Server, Azure Data Warehouse, Docker), ensuring reliability for downstream forecasting and financial analysis.
Optimized SQL-based analytical workloads through indexing, partitioning, and caching, reducing query latency by 83% (60 min → under 10 min), enabling faster iteration on forecasting models.

Research Assistant  @  Florida State University
June 2024 – September 2024
Researched generative models (GANs, VAEs, RNNs, Diffusion) under Dr. Bin Ouyang for synthetic molecular data generation, focused on discovering stable, sustainable materials for lithium-ion battery applications using AI-driven compound synthesis.
Benchmarked and fine-tuned deep learning models (NequIP) via transfer learning across an 11,000+ material dataset, improving prediction consistency by 15% through iterative experimentation and hyperparameter optimization.
Designed and executed controlled experiments across multiple model architectures using A/B testing and statistical comparison methods, tracked via MLflow, ensuring rigorous, reproducible model evaluation and informing experimentation design practices.

Software Developer  @  S&P Global
January 2022 – June 2023
Built a production-grade data extraction platform processing 10,000+ documents/day, combining OCR and CNN-based classification models to convert unstructured PDFs and scanned documents into structured datasets for downstream analysis and modeling.
Engineered cloud-based data pipelines (AWS S3, Athena, BigQuery) to ingest, transform, and serve large-scale datasets, enabling analysts and downstream models to access up-to-date structured data within minutes.
Designed a modular, reusable Python extraction framework with CDC-based updates and 80% test coverage, and developed REST API integrations with schema validation and CI/CD (GitHub Actions) to improve data quality and deployment reliability.
